SUMMARY

Family Service League is seeking a full-time Social Worker for the MCT Unbraided Program in Hauppauge, NY. The Social Worker will provide in-person and telephonic crisis intervention, de-escalation, and assessment as part of our Mobile Crisis Team.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• The Social Worker will conduct clinical crisis assessments as part of a Mobile Crisis team serving all of Suffolk County for adults, adolescents and children with the full range of DSM diagnoses, including both mental health and substance use disorders.
  • Screen and collect referral and collateral information from third party callers to inform assessment and linkage to immediate and long term supports.
  • The Social Worker will provide telephonic triage, assessment and de-escalation to determine the best disposition for individuals in crisis.
  • Utilize resources such as PSYCKES to review relevant clinical information.
  • Work closely with law enforcement to accept referrals and provide a co-response to individuals in crisis, when clinically necessary. 
  • Complete all clinical documentation in accordance with NYS Office of Mental Health in an electronic medical record.
  • The Social Worker will provide in-person/in-community de-escalation, clinical assessment and linkage to individuals in crisis.
  • Coordinate with outside providers and collateral contacts.
  • Work as part of a multidisciplinary team, conferencing cases, communicating outcomes and providing follow up.
  • Attend routine supervision/team meeting.
  • Complete training and maintain proficiency with de-escalation skills.
  • All other duties as assigned.

 

QUALIFICATIONS

Master’s Degree in a relevant clinical field is required.

LMSW, LCSW, LMHC or limited permit is preferred.

At least six months of experience in a behavioral health setting required; clinical experience with mental health and/or substance use disorders is preferred.

Proficient computer skills, including Microsoft Office required; experience with an Electronic Health Record is preferred.

Excellent interpersonal and verbal and written communication skills are required.

Ability to problem solve, multitask, make clear decisions and work as part of a team are required.

Valid and clean New York State Driver’s License and ability to safely operate a motor vehicle required.

Bilingual in Spanish is preferred.
